Understanding Different Bet Types and Their Payouts

The foundation of potential winnings lies in understanding the various bet types available. A moneyline bet is the simplest form, where you’re betting on which team will win a game outright. Payouts on moneyline bets are determined by the odds, which reflect the perceived probability of each team winning. Favorites have negative odds (e.g., -150), indicating the amount you need to bet to win $100. Underdogs have positive odds (e.g., +120), indicating the amount you would win on a $100 bet. Spread betting introduces a handicap, with teams being assigned a point advantage or disadvantage. To win a spread bet, your chosen team must cover the spread, meaning they win by more than the spread amount or lose by less. Payouts are generally fixed at -110, meaning you need to bet $110 to win $100. Parlays combine multiple bets into one, offering potentially larger payouts but also increasing the risk, as all selections must win for the parlay to be successful.

The Impact of Odds Formats

Different regions and betting platforms utilize different odds formats, which can impact how you perceive potential winnings. American odds, as described above, are common in the United States. Decimal odds (e.g., 2.50) represent the total payout for every $1 bet, including the return of the stake. Fractional odds (e.g., 5/2) represent the profit relative to the stake. It's crucial to understand how to convert between these formats to accurately compare odds and potential returns across different platforms. Many online tools can facilitate this conversion, ensuring you make informed betting choices. Failing to properly understand the odds can lead to miscalculations and potentially lower winnings than anticipated. Always double-check the odds format being used before placing your bet.

Evaluating roo bet’s Specific Odds and Margins

roo bet, like all sportsbooks, incorporate a margin into their odds, also known as the “vig” or “juice”. This margin ensures the sportsbook generates a profit, regardless of the outcome of the event. The margin is reflected in the odds, meaning the implied probability of an event happening (based on the odds) will always be slightly higher than the actual probability. When evaluating potential winnings on roo bet, it’s important to consider these margins. Comparing the odds offered by roo bet with those offered by other sportsbooks is a prudent practice. This comparison will reveal whether roo bet is offering competitive odds or if you might find better value elsewhere. Tools and websites dedicated to odds comparison are readily available and can save you significant time and effort. A small difference in odds can add up over time, especially for frequent bettors.

Risk Management Strategies for Maximizing Returns

Maximizing potential winnings isn't solely about finding the best odds; it’s also about managing risk effectively. A crucial aspect of risk management is bankroll management, which involves setting a budget for your betting activities and consistently adhering to it. A common rule of thumb is to never bet more than 1-5% of your bankroll on a single wager. This helps to mitigate the risk of significant losses and allows you to weather losing streaks. Diversification is another important risk management strategy. Spreading your bets across different sports, bet types, and events can reduce your overall exposure to risk. Avoid chasing losses, which is a common mistake among bettors. Instead of increasing your bet size in an attempt to recoup losses, stick to your predetermined bankroll management plan. Disciplined betting is key to long-term success.

The Importance of Value Betting

Value betting involves identifying bets where the odds offered by the sportsbook are higher than your own assessment of the probability of the event occurring. This requires a thorough understanding of the sport, team statistics, and other relevant factors. Value betting is not about predicting the outcome of an event with certainty; it’s about identifying situations where the odds are mispriced. It requires researching and building your own probabilities, and comparing them to the odds offered by roo bet. Finding value bets consistently takes time, effort, and a disciplined approach.
